Food Network star Guy Fieri and his Diners, Drive-Ins and Dives show have spotlighted Sam's No. 3. 


From the restaurant's website:
"Sam's No. 3 was the third of five Coney Islands restaurants opened by Sam Armatas during the 1920s. The original location was at 1527 Curtis Street in the heart of downtown Denver. On Sept. 28th, 1998, Sam's son Spero with his grandsons Sam, Alex and Patrick re-established his most famous of the Coney Islands restaurants, Sam's No. 3. In honor of the age-old tradition, they made a promise to each other to continue to provide excellent quality of food and embrace the inviting, warm atmosphere started by 'Mr. Sam' more than 80 years ago!"


Kids' menu. Full bar. Serving breakfast, lunch and dinner daily. Late-night Fri–Sat.


"Try this friendly diner's best-selling supreme breakfast burrito with ham, bacon, sausage, gyro, eggs and potatoes."
